Career path

Electrical Instrumentation Engineer

Designs and maintains advanced electrical systems and instrumentation for industrial applications, ensuring precision and efficiency.

Control Systems Specialist

Focuses on developing and optimizing control systems for automation, integrating advanced electrical instrumentation techniques.

Instrumentation Technician

Installs, calibrates, and troubleshoots electrical instrumentation equipment, ensuring compliance with industry standards.
